If you have a small balcony, you can still grow herbs. You will need to choose the right herbs, get a few pots, and make sure you have enough sunlight. Once you have those things, you can start growing your herbs.
The first thing you need to do is choose the right herbs. Some herbs need more space than others, so you need to make sure you pick the right ones. Some good herbs for a small balcony include basil, chives, cilantro, and mint.
Once you have your herbs picked out, you need to get some pots. You can find pots at your local gardening store or online. Make sure you get pots that are the right size for your herbs.
The last thing you need is sunlight. Herbs need at least six hours of sunlight per day. If you can’t get that much sunlight on your balcony, you can grow herbs that don’t need as much sun.

What are the easiest herbs to grow on balcony?
There are a number of herbs that are easy to grow on a balcony. These include basil, chives, cilantro, mint, oregano, rosemary, and thyme. All of these herbs only require a small amount of space and can be grown in pots or containers.
Basil is a popular herb that is easy to grow on a balcony. It prefers full sun and well-drained soil. Chives also prefer full sun and well-drained soil.
Cilantro prefers partial sun and moist, well-drained soil. Mint prefers partial sun and moist, well-drained soil. Oregano prefers full sun and well-drained soil.
Rosemary prefers full sun and well-drained soil. Thyme prefers full sun and well-drained soil.
All of these herbs are easy to grow and only require a small amount of space.
They can all be grown in pots or containers on a balcony.

Can you have an herb garden on a balcony?
Yes, you can have an herb garden on a balcony! There are a few things to keep in mind, though, to make sure your herbs thrive.
First, make sure your balcony gets enough sunlight.
Herbs need at least 6 hours of sunlight per day to grow well. If your balcony doesn’t get that much sun, you can try growing herbs in pots on a sunny windowsill instead.
Second, choose the right soil.
Herbs need well-drained soil that’s rich in nutrients. You can either buy potting mix specifically for herbs, or make your own by mixing equal parts sand, compost, and perlite.
Third, water your herbs regularly.
They’ll need to be watered more often in hot weather, and less often in cooler weather. Be sure to check the soil before watering, and only water when the top inch or so is dry.
With a little care, you can grow a beautiful and bountiful herb garden on your balcony!
How do you grow herbs in a small space?
When it comes to growing herbs, you don’t need a lot of space. In fact, many herbs can be grown in small pots or containers on a windowsill or in a sunny spot in your kitchen.
Here are a few tips for growing herbs in a small space:
1. Choose the right herbs. Some herbs, like basil and mint, grow quite large and will quickly take over a small space. Others, like chives and thyme, stay relatively small.
When choosing herbs for a small space, it’s best to stick with the latter.
2. Give them plenty of light. Herbs need at least six hours of sunlight each day, so a sunny windowsill is ideal.
If you don’t have a lot of natural light in your home, you can also grow herbs under grow lights.
3. Keep them well watered. Small pots or containers dry out quickly, so it’s important to check your herbs daily and water them when the soil is dry to the touch.
4. Fertilize regularly. Herbs are heavy feeders and will need to be fertilized every few weeks to keep them healthy. Use a liquid fertilizer or a slow-release fertilizer designed for herbs.
5. Harvest often. The best way to keep your herbs growing strong is to harvest them regularly. Cut off the leaves or stems as needed, and don’t be afraid to use them in your cooking.

Growing herbs on west facing balcony
Herbs are one of the easiest and most rewarding plants to grow, whether you have a large garden or a small west-facing balcony. Not only do they provide a delicious addition to your cooking, but they also have a host of health benefits.
Here are a few tips on how to get the most out of your herb garden:
1. Choose the right plants. Some herbs, like basil, thrive in full sun, while others, like cilantro, prefer partial shade. Do a little research on which plants will do best in your particular situation.
2. Make sure your containers have drainage holes. This is crucial, as herbs can quickly become waterlogged and rot.
3. Use a quality potting mix.
Herb plants need a light, well-draining soil. You can find speciality mixes at your local garden center, or make your own by mixing equal parts sand, perlite, and peat moss.
4. Water regularly, but don’t overdo it.
Water your herbs when the soil is dry to the touch. Be careful not to overwater, as this can lead to root rot.
5. Fertilize sparingly.
Too much fertilizer can actually burn herb plants. Once a month is usually sufficient.
With a little care and attention, you can enjoy fresh herbs all year round!
